Favorite Stuffing Recipe

Ingredients:

2 cups diced celery
¼ cup butter
½ cup onion
2½ quarts bread cubes
1 cup butter cubed and combined with 1 cup of water. Heat until butter melts. Pour over cubes or croutons.
Add ½ tsp. salt
½ tsp.pepper
1 tsp.poultry seasoning

Directions:

Cook celery and onion in ¼ cup butter until tender. Add remaining ingredients. Toss lightly. If it seems dry, add more boiling water and more butter. I like to add 1 chopped apple to keep it moist. Taste for flavor and add whatever is needed. I usually buy the flavored croutons at the grocery store.

Personal Notes:

I love dressing on the moist side. Taste your dressing for flavor before placing in a roaster and roast for about 1 hour at 300. You may add a little sage if croutons are not flavored.
